Fender Road Worn '60s Stratocaster OW

owner: Roll Your Own

Fender Road Worn '60s Stratocaster in Olympic White.
Replaced the rosewood fingerboard neck with a maple fingerboard neck from the same Road Worn series '50s Stratocaster.
